Mobil 1 and McLaren to celebrate 20-year relationship in Formula 1

With the 2014 Formula 1 season starting this weekend at the Australian Grand Prix, ExxonMobil and McLaren will celebrate their 20th Anniversary of technical and commercial partnership. In order to celebrate the milestone, the McLaren Forumla 1 cars will feature a special livery in Australia that will include both Moil 1 and Mobil brands.
"To celebrate the 20th anniversary of Mobil 1's relationship with McLaren, we are looking forward to showcasing a special branding scheme during the first race of the 2014 season," said Artis Brown, global motorsports manager, Mobil 1. "There is a lot of energy entering this race. Not only are we celebrating our 20th anniversary with McLaren, but we will be welcoming Kevin Magnussen to the team. When you combine these elements with the introduction of the new V-6 engine, this should be a very exciting weekend."
Jonathan Neale, Chief Operating Officer and Acting CEO of McLaren Mercedes said, "We are privileged to have worked closely with ExxonMobil over a very successful 20 years and counting. During 332 races together we have achieved four world championships, 78 wins, 229 podium finishes and 76 pole positions, which is testament to our powerful technology partnership. Seeing the Mobil fuels branding alongside Mobil 1 on the MP-4 29 is a great recognition of the relationship's contribution to performance over our two decades together."
Along with this 20-year partnership celebration, ExxonMobil will also celebrate the return of the Mobil fuel brand at 7-Eleven Australia's convenience stores on the Australian east coast metropolitan markets for the first time since the sale of ExxonMobil's retail assets in 2010. Earlier this year, Mobil Oil Australia announced a long-term agreement for the sale of Mobil-branded fuelsat 7-Eleven Australia's convenience stores on Australia's east coast.
ExxonMobil and McLaren began their partnership in 1995, with ExxonMobil proving Mobil 1 synthetic lubricant brand, developing new lubricants and fuels designed for McLaren's race team.
"We are proud to celebrate our relationship with McLaren this weekend and we are looking forward to an exciting season," said Brown.
